arduino教程

时间:2025-04-28

arduino教程

Arduino教程:从入门到精通的实用指南

一、Arduino简介 Arduino是一款开源电子原型平台,它由一个简单的*件(Arduino板)和一个基于C/C++的软件开发环境(ArduinoIDE)组成。通过Arduino,你可以轻松地将电子元件连接起来,实现各种创意项目。

二、Arduino入门必备

1.*件准备

Arduino板(如ArduinoUno)

电阻、电容、LED灯等电子元件

准备一个面包板和跳线

2.软件安装

下载并安装ArduinoIDE

配置ArduinoIDE,确保与你的Arduino板兼容

三、Arduino编程基础

1.变量和数据类型

变量:用于存储数据

数据类型:int、float、char等

2.控制结构

条件语句:if、else

循环语句:for、while

自定义函数:编写自己的函数

内置函数:使用ArduinoIDE提供的函数

四、Arduino与传感器

1.读取模拟传感器数据

使用analogRead()函数读取模拟值

将模拟值转换为数字值

2.读取数字传感器数据

使用digitalRead()函数读取数字值

控制数字输出

五、Arduino与执行器

1.控制LED灯

使用digitalWrite()函数控制LED灯的亮灭

2.控制电机 使用WM(脉冲宽度调制)控制电机速度

六、Arduino项目实战

1.温湿度传感器

使用DHT11或DHT22传感器读取温湿度数据

2.自动浇水系统 使用土壤湿度传感器控制浇水时间

七、Arduino扩展模块

1.I2C模块

使用I2C模块扩展更多功能

2.SI模块 使用SI模块连接更多设备

八、Arduino与网络

1.使用WiFi模块连接互联网

发送和接收数据

2.使用蓝牙模块实现无线通信

九、Arduino与物联网

1.物联网概念

物联网(IoT)的基本概念

2.Arduino在物联网中的应用 实现智能家居、工业自动化等

十、Arduino社区与资源

1.Arduino社区

加入Arduino社区,获取更多资源

2.Arduino教程和项目案例 学习更多Arduino教程和项目案例

十一、Arduino的未来

1.Arduino的发展趋势

Arduino在电子原型领域的持续发展

2.Arduino在教育领域的应用 Arduino在教育中的普及和应用

通过**的Arduino教程,读者可以了解到Arduino的基本知识、编程技巧、项目实战以及未来发展趋势。希望这篇文章能帮助你从入门到精通,开启你的Arduino之旅。

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。

本站作品均来源互联网收集整理,版权归原创作者所有,与金辉网无关,如不慎侵犯了你的权益,请联系Q451197900告知,我们将做删除处理!

Copyright宝润通 备案号: 蜀ICP备2024103751号-10